Health officials say they are unable to sustain the 24-hour emergency services at Carman Memorial Hospital.

Because of a temporary physician shortage in the community, the Emergency Department will operate at reduced hours effective November 1, 2020 through to April 30, 2021.

Until further notice, the emergency department will be open daily (seven days a week) from 8:00 a.m until 8:00 p.m, closed daily from 8:00 p.m to 8:00 a.m.

In the meantime, officials say recruiting is ongoing and the situation will be re-evaluated in April, 2021.
